April Weather in Kardamyli, Greece

Last updated: August 21, 2025

April in Kardamyli, Greece welcomes spring with an inviting blend of mild temperatures and refreshing rainfall. Daily highs reach a comfortable 26°C (78°F), while the nights cool down to an average of 13°C (56°F), making it a perfect time for outdoor exploration. With a minimum temperature dipping to 2°C (36°F), visitors should be prepared for cooler evenings. The month experiences 36 mm (1.4 in) of precipitation over approximately 6 days, contributing to the lush, vibrant landscape. A relative humidity of 75% enhances the crispness of the air, offering an invigorating escape for those looking to embrace the natural beauty of this charming coastal town.

April Precipitation in Kardamyli

In April, Kardamyli, Greece, experiences a noticeable dip in precipitation, receiving just 36 mm (1.4 in) of rain over 6 days. This trend marks a significant decrease from the wetter months earlier in the year, where January alone recorded 119 mm (4.7 in) across 12 days. As spring unfolds, the landscape begins to dry out, paving the way for more vibrant outdoor activities with fewer rainy interruptions. With May following closely with an even lower 29 mm (1.1 in) and just 4 days of rain, it’s clear that the transition into early summer brings a welcome respite from precipitation, allowing residents and visitors to enjoy the region's stunning natural beauty.

April UV Index in Kardamyli

April marks a significant transition in Kardamyli, Greece, as the UV Index reaches a notable 9, indicating a very high exposure category. This sharp increase from March's UV Index of 7 means that sunburn risk rises dramatically, with a reduced burn time of just 15 minutes. As spring unfolds, locals and visitors alike should be vigilant about sun protection, preparing for the sunnier days ahead. This pattern foreshadows an even higher UV Index in May, peaking at 10, emphasizing the importance of safeguarding skin during these months.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
